Dear Sriman,

 

In this group we have learned members and we all know what is what. Since Oct

2005 we have been uncovering the truth of Lakshmi Shank, if you do a message

search you'll find years of research. First of all, Lakshmi Shank belongs at the

top of a science known a Conchology, and whelk has no place there, belong, as it

does, to the species of Whelk (BContrairium). They are not even related to conch

and differ in X-rays, and other points. Selling whelk shells as " Lakshmi Shank "

is listed as " Fraud " anywhere in the world. Any Conchologist will concur. Please

see this link for more information: http://www.p-g-a.org/conch-artl.html (from

PGA). There is no disagreement in our 1000+ person group regarding the truth of

Lakshmi Shank, which, by the way, cost about 6,000-20,000 Rs per gram these

days, depending on Jati type or smooth milk Lakshmi Shank like shown by Chandra

Shekar. The real thing is not so easy, as it should not be. So live and learn in

this group, there's no more debate on Lakshmi Shank being

" Dakshin-turbinella-pyrum " and NOTHING else can ever be Lakshmi Shank as found

in Indian Oceans from Burma to Sri Lanka. The whelk are imported by rascals who

play off the stupidity of even the Brahmins (who didn't know - just like you)

and are sold to the people for $100, more or less, and that is all they are

worth. You get what you pay for and if you want a real Lakshmi Shank this group

has real suppliers. But the Lakshmi Shank should NOT be cheap! You must spend up

to a crore to get a really good milk Lakshmi Shank, which are not seen even in

London's Museum of Natural History. Only Pt Tata, backed by Chandra Shekar have

shown the ultimate in Lakshmi Shanks.
